Iran Warns to Set Fire to Enemy’s Economic, Political Interests in Case of War

Lieutenant Commander of the Islamic Revolution Guards Corps (IRGC) Brigadier General Hossein Salami in threatening remarks on Thursday warned Israel and the US that the Iranian Armed Forces will annihilate all their interests in case they take the slightest military move against Iran.

“We monitor their acts day and night and will take every opportunity to set fire to all their economic and political interests if they do a wrong deed,” Salami said, addressing Basiji (volunteer) forces in Tehran on Thursday.

Alluding to the US and Israel, he warned that in case of enemy action, Iran will “cut off enemies’ hands and fingers will then send its dust to the air”.

In relevant remarks in July, Salami played down the US officials’ war rhetoric against Iran, warning that the US knows its slightest hostile move would receive a crushing response.

“Today the US knows that the slightest move against the Islamic Iran will ruin its house of dream,” Brigadier General Salami said.

He pointed to the US officials’ catch phrase “all military option are still on the table” even after the Vienna nuclear agreement, and said, “The Americans have always resorted to bullying because they lack diplomatic skills… .”

On May 7, Brigadier General Salami stressed that the country had prepared itself for the worst case scenario.

“We have prepared ourselves for the most dangerous scenarios and this is no big deal and is simple to digest for US; we welcome war with the US as we do believe that it will be the scene for our success to display the real potentials of our power,” Salami said in an interview with the state-run TV at the time.
